Feel the Stress Leave Your Body at Széchenyi Spa
With 15 indoor pools and 3 open-air bathing facilities, the Széchenyi Spa is considered the largest in all of Europe. It is most known for its massive outdoor thermal pool that has a running temperature of 40°C, perfect to keep you warm even on the coldest winter days! Just picture floating in a pool of healing water.
The Széchenyi Spa feeds on the city’s extended thermal spring network running below the earth. This hidden gem has always pulled in settlers and cultures throughout history, starting with the Roman Empire, who developed their own bathing culture in the location of today’s Budapest during the 1st to the 5th century. Visit Budapest GastroCellar
Visit a hidden gem in the heart of the city to sample the famous Hungarian Palinkas. Different from whiskey or vodka, palinka is made exclusively from different types of fruits and has a pleasant aromatic smell. Learn all about the history of the delicious beverage as you enjoy a guided tour of the Budapest GastroCellar and a one-of-a-kind interactive exhibition. Then, relish in the taste of one of the best samples of palinka (spirits; non-alcoholic drinks are also available).
